About
Arvora was founded to build homes that respond thoughtfully to their surroundings: small schemes, contemporary and timeless architecture, materials that age well, and a team that stays on site until the last door closes properly.
We design in-house, tender construction to contractors we know, and supervise the work ourselves. Nine homes per development is not a marketing position — it is the largest number one team can hold to a consistent standard of detail.
Our reference points are Nordic: honest materials, restrained detailing, generous proportion — soft yet corporate, human but precise. Our engineering is Mediterranean: shading, thermal mass, cross-ventilation and waterproofing designed for a climate that reaches 38°C and then delivers a winter's rain in three days.
We publish internal area, covered veranda and outdoor space as separate figures. We put the specification in writing before you reserve. We lodge contracts of sale at the Land Registry promptly. None of that is remarkable — it should simply be normal.

Limassol was building quickly and finishing carelessly. We took the opposite position: small schemes, one team from concept to snagging, and a size we could genuinely supervise. Nine is not a marketing number — it is the limit of honest attention.
The architecture borrows Scandinavian discipline — quiet volumes, honest materials, generous proportion. The engineering is entirely local: thermal mass, deep reveals, waterproofing designed for a coast that reaches 38°C and then delivers a winter's rain in three days.
Collection, Signature and Estates differ in setting, scale and privacy — never in build quality. A resident of Arvora Collection I stands behind the same specification, the same supervision and the same named contact as an Estates owner.

How we work
Nine homes per development so every residence gets a good aspect.
One team from concept to snagging, so intent survives to site.
Internal, veranda and outdoor areas published separately.
Insulation, shading and glazing specified before any gadget.
The material and system schedule forms part of the contract.
A named contact through the defect liability period.
